The role we’re hiring for:
A Business Development Manager to join our team based within a commutable distance to Bromsgrove. This role involves developing business within targeted sectors such as FM, housing, and end users, promoting our maintenance expertise within the Fire & Security arena.

Key responsibilities include:
1. Develop and maintain strong client relationships with existing maintenance accounts, ensuring satisfaction and cross-selling to increase revenue and retention.
2. Drive new business opportunities across sectors such as Facilities Management (FM), Housing, and end-user markets through direct sales and networking.
3. Manage third-party remedial works, especially for fire doors and fire-stopping systems, ensuring compliance and timely project completion.
4. Collaborate with internal teams to monitor service delivery, resolve issues proactively, and meet or exceed account expectations and margin targets.
Preferred experience includes:
* Proven sales experience in fire and security systems, focusing on maintenance contracts/services in commercial and/or residential sectors.
* Knowledge of British Standards related to fire safety maintenance (e.g., BS 5839, BS 5266) and familiarity with SFG20 standards for FM providers.
* Understanding of fire door inspection and compartmentation principles, with the ability to identify compliance needs and remedial opportunities.
* A track record of achieving or exceeding revenue targets, ideally managing a sales pipeline exceeding £200k annually.
